Google Home Extension for Visual Studio Code wurde speziell für Google Home-Entwickler entwickelt. Mit dieser Erweiterung erhältst du Zugriff auf Google Assistant Simulator, Google Cloud Logging, Home Graph Viewer und andere Tools, die den Entwicklungsprozess für Matter und Smart-Home-Geräte vereinfachen.
Funktionen der Google Home-Erweiterung
Google Assistant-Simulator
Wenn du testen möchtest, ob deine Smart-Home-Geräte ordnungsgemäß mit der Google Home-Umgebung funktionieren, kannst du jederzeit mit Assistant Simulator interagieren, ohne VS Code zu verlassen.
Ähnlich wie mit dem vorhandenen Simulator in der Actions Console können Sie mit Assistant Simulator Ihre Geräte ganz einfach durch Eingabe Ihrer Abfragen steuern, z. B. „Schalte das Licht ein“. In VS Code antwortet Assistant Simulator mit Textnachrichten basierend auf Ihren Befehlen, z. B. „Alles klar, das Licht wird eingeschaltet.“ Weitere Informationen finden Sie unter Google Assistant-Simulator verwenden.
Batch-Äußerungen
Wenn Sie die Einbindung von Google Home wie ein automatisiertes System testen möchten, können Sie Batch-Äußerungen an den Google Assistant-Simulator senden. Dazu müssen Sie ein Äußerungsskript ausführen. Weitere Informationen finden Sie unter Batch-Äußerungen ausführen.
Cloud Logging
Cloud Logging bietet Informationen zur Fehlerbehebung und wichtige Messwerte, die dir Einblicke in die Nutzung deiner Aktion geben. Zur Vereinfachung der Entwicklung zeigt Google Home Extension während der Fehlerbehebung Google Cloud Logging-Echtzeitnachrichten direkt neben Ihrem Code an. Weitere Informationen finden Sie unter Cloud Logging ansehen.
Home Graph-Anzeige
Der Home Graph Viewer ist jetzt direkt in Google Home Extension verfügbar. So kannst du den Status des Geräts in Home Graph in VS Code prüfen. Weitere Informationen finden Sie unter Home Graph ansehen und Tests ausführen.
Google Home-Erweiterung für VS Code installieren
Führen Sie zum Installieren von Google Home Extension die folgenden Schritte in VS Code aus:
- Klicken Sie in der Aktivitätsleiste auf das Symbol Erweiterungen.
Suchen Sie nach
google home
und klicken Sie dann auf Installieren.
Sie können die Google Home Extension auch direkt aus dem VS Code Marketplace herunterladen.
Laden Sie Google Home Extension herunter.
Google Home-Erweiterung für VS Code einrichten
Nachdem Sie Google Home Extension installiert und VS Code neu geladen haben, müssen Sie sich anmelden und ein Projekt auswählen, bevor Sie Assistant Simulator verwenden und Cloud Logging aufrufen können.
Über Google anmelden und Cloud-Projekt auswählen
Sie können sich über Google Home Extension in Ihrem Entwicklerkonto anmelden und VS Code autorisieren, in Ihrem Namen mit Google-Diensten zu kommunizieren.
Klicken Sie in der Aktivitätsleiste auf das Symbol Google Home, um Google Home Extension zu öffnen.
Klicken Sie auf Über Google anmelden, um die Anmeldeansicht in Ihrem Browser zu öffnen.
Wählen Sie das Konto aus, das mit Ihren Smart-Home-Geräten verknüpft ist.
Klicken Sie auf der Autorisierungsseite Über Google anmelden auf Zulassen.
Ein Browsertab wird geöffnet und das Dialogfeld Open Visual Studio Code (Visual Studio Code öffnen). Klicken Sie auf Open Visual Studio Code, um fortzufahren.
Du wirst zu VS Code weitergeleitet. Dort ist deine Erlaubnis erforderlich, damit die Google Home-Erweiterung einen URI öffnen kann. Klicken Sie auf Open (Öffnen), um den Anmeldevorgang abzuschließen.
Nach der Anmeldung lädt Google Home Extension Ihre Projekte. Wenn Sie fertig sind, klicken Sie auf Projekt auswählen.
Wählen Sie im angezeigten Drop-down-Fenster Projekt suchen und auswählen Ihr Smart-Home-Projekt aus.
Google Home-Erweiterung für VS Code verwenden
Entwicklerressourcen ansehen
Klicke unter HILFE UND FEEDBACK auf Erste Schritte & Ressourcen, um die Seite Ressourcen zu öffnen. Dort findest du hilfreiche Informationen für die Entwicklung mit der Google Home-Plattform.
Google Assistant-Simulator verwenden
Klicken Sie in der Seitenleiste auf GOOGLE ASSISTANT SIMULATOR, um Assistant Simulator in VS Code zu öffnen. Geben Sie Ihre Abfrage im Feld Nachricht ein und drücken Sie Enter
.
Sie können Assistant Simulator-Antworten aufrufen und auf die Schaltfläche nach Ihrer Abfrage klicken, um sie erneut zu senden.
Batch-Äußerungen ausführen
Bewegen Sie den Mauszeiger auf die Menüleiste GOOGLE ASSISTANT SIMULATOR und wählen Sie eine der folgenden Optionen aus, um Skripts einzurichten:
Klicken Sie auf
, um vorhandene Äußerungsskripts zu öffnen.Klicken Sie auf
, um den Verlauf in einem*.utterance
-Skript zu speichern.
Wählen Sie eine der folgenden Optionen aus, um Batch-Äußerungen zu senden:
- Klicken Sie auf , um aus dem Drop-down-Fenster ein Äußerungsskript auszuwählen.
Öffnen Sie eine
*.utterance
-Datei direkt und klicken Sie auf .
Cloud Logging ansehen
Klicken Sie unter SCHNELLER ZUGRIFF auf Cloud-Logs, um die Seite Cloud-Logs zu öffnen. Dort finden Sie die Logs für das ausgewählte Projekt.
Nutzer können Logs nach Schweregrad und Zeitraum filtern.
Standardmäßig sind die Logs auf 50 Zeilen beschränkt. Wenn der Nutzer weitere Logs sehen möchte, scrollen Sie nach unten und klicken Sie auf Mehr.
Home Graph ansehen und Tests durchführen
Klicken Sie unter SCHNELLER ZUGRIFF auf Home Graph Viewer, um das Steuerfeld Home Graph Viewer zu öffnen. Dort finden Sie Geräte, die zum ausgewählten Projekt gehören. Sie können auch auf Test ausführen klicken, um Tests für das Gerät auszuführen.
Dadurch wird die Testsuite in Ihrem Browser mit dem ausgewählten Gerät gestartet und kann getestet werden. Klicken Sie auf Starten und warten Sie auf die Testergebnisse.
Sie können sich die Testdetails und die Logs ansehen, nachdem alle Tests abgeschlossen sind.
Feedback geben
Wenn Sie uns Feedback geben oder Verbesserungsvorschläge für Google Home Extension senden möchten, wählen Sie eine der folgenden Optionen aus:
- Klicken Sie im Bereich HILFE UND FEEDBACK auf Feedback geben, um Vorschläge zu machen.
- Klicken Sie im Bereich HILFE UND FEEDBACK auf Problem melden, um Probleme mit Google Home Extension zu melden.
- Außerdem haben wir auf der Seite Ressourcen ein Feedbacksymbol hinzugefügt.